Emirates hosts 4th World Airline Bowling Tournament

Emirates Airline will host the 4th World Airline Bowling Championship (WABC), to be held at the Dubai International Bowling Centre from 30th October-1st November.

Thirty two teams from more than 11 international airlines have already confirmed participation and will compete for trophies in the singles, doubles, masters and team events as well as the coveted World Airline Bowling Cup Champion Team accolade.

Competition hosts Emirates, who won the last WABC in 2006, will defend their title with a strong contingent of six teams.

Staff from a number of Emirates Group departments and divisions within Dubai will compete, ably captained by Dilan Selvadurai, the WABC reigning champion.

Mohammed Al Khaja, Chairman of Emirates' Bowling Club, which is organising as well as hosting the event, said:

"After the successes of the previous World Airline Bowling tournaments in Dubai, the number of participating teams has again increased this year, which will undoubtedly create an extremely challenging and exciting competition. We are delighted to welcome teams from 11 other airlines from as far afield as USA, Australia and Singapore and look forward to witnessing the excellent team spirit which is always a feature of the WABC."


The opening ceremony is scheduled for 9am on Thursday October 30th at the Dubai International Bowling Centre, Al Mamzar, Deira, followed by team events from 10.30am to 3pm.

Doubles events, both male and female, take place on Friday October 31st from 10am-1pm and from 2pm-5pm.

Saturday November 1st sees action from the male and female Singles Squads between 9am-12noon; 1pm-4pm and 4.20pm-6pm.

Free entry is granted to spectators, who are welcome throughout the tournament and there is no need to book.

The awards will be presented at an invitation-only ceremony and gala dinner on Saturday November 1st.
